Abstract
An electrically steerable array of 968 dipoles for illuminating the parabolic antenna of the Ooty radio telescope at 327 MHz is described. The array has been divided into 22 modules of 44 dipoles each. Dipoles in each module are fed in series through directional couplers and phase shifters. A simple design of trombone type phase shifters with non-contacting choke joints has been developed that gives a loss of less than 1.2 dB in each module at 327 MHz. The antenna beam can be steered between ±36° in declination.
